Journal entry by Cecilia Glenn —
It's been a month since mom passed and though the tears still occassionally flow, life continues to move ahead. Family is trickling in from out of state for mom's celebration of life service and soon we'll be laughing and crying over old pictures and baking mom's favorite cookies to share with others at the luncheon. And of course there may be a game of Skippo, yahtze or cribbage in the mix too!
Since it's been a while since we first posted the details, we thought it would be helpful to send a reminder. As a family, the question has come up on what to wear. Mom didn't always match, she loved bright colors and liked to be comfortable so we're going to take her lead. Wear whatever makes you comfortable...we aren't a super formal bunch so if you don't feel like wearing a suit or dress...don't. If you do, that's fine too! We'll just be happy to see you there!!
A Celebration of Life service will take place on Monday, September 23, 2019, with visitation at 10:00 am and service at 11:00 am at Edina Community Lutheran Church 4113 W 54th Street, Edina (952-926-3808). Luncheon to follow. Memorial donations preferred to Park Nicollet/Methodist Hospice Care.
